Power characteristics of photovoltaic systems can have multiple peaks when under partially shaded conditions. This can cause traditional power tracking methods to operate at the lower power peaks. This research looks at two alternative power tracking method designed for partially shaded conditions. Random Perturbation search method was one of the algorithms investigated. The method is based on perturbations of random but limited magnitude. Even Perturbation search method was the second algorithm investigated. The algorithm scans through the appropriate range of operation with constant size perturbations. Both methods operate on periodic bases for considerations of power loss. Through experiments both search methods have demonstrated good accuracy and consistency with uniform irradiation and for most cases of partial shading. The search methods were combined with the Perturb and Observe' algorithm to improve the response speed to irradiance changes. Both of the improved methods showed significant improvement in response speed and results were consistently accurate. Overall, the developed maximum power tracking methods have met the design goals.
